What Is the Elementor AI Website Builder?

Elementor’s AI Website Builder is not just a single feature—it’s an integrated suite of AI-powered tools woven into the core page building experience. From the moment you create a new page, AI assists with layout structure, content generation, image selection, and even code-level optimizations.

The foundation of this system is the Atomic Editor, introduced in Elementor 4.0, which provides a unified editing interface where AI capabilities are accessible at every step. Rather than switching between separate tools for design, copywriting, and optimization, everything happens within a single canvas.

Core AI Features Reshaping Web Design

1. AI Wireframe Generator

Starting a new design from a blank canvas is often the hardest part. Elementor’s AI Wireframe Generator solves this by asking a few simple questions about your business type, design preferences, and page goals. Within seconds, it produces a complete wireframe with properly structured sections, placeholder content, and suggested color schemes.

The wireframes aren’t generic templates—they adapt to modern design conventions for your specific industry. An e-commerce store wireframe differs significantly from a portfolio layout, and the AI understands these nuances.

2. AI Content and Copywriting

Writing compelling copy for each section of a website is time-consuming. Elementor’s built-in AI writing assistant generates headlines, body text, calls-to-action, and even FAQ content directly within the editor. It supports multiple tones (professional, casual, persuasive) and can match your brand voice consistently across all pages.

The AI doesn’t just write—it understands context. If you’re building a pricing page, it knows to generate feature comparisons and value propositions. If you’re designing a contact page, it suggests trust signals and clear CTAs.

3. Smart Layout Suggestions

As you build pages, Elementor’s AI continuously analyzes your design decisions and offers intelligent suggestions. Add a testimonial section, and the AI might suggest adding a star rating component or client logos nearby. Create a hero section, and it proposes matching subheadings and button styles.

This contextual assistance feels less like automation and more like having a senior designer looking over your shoulder, offering helpful recommendations without being intrusive.

4. AI Image Generation and Enhancement

Finding the right images for a website is often the biggest bottleneck. Elementor now integrates AI image generation, allowing you to create custom visuals by describing what you need. Need a photo of a modern office with plants and natural lighting? The AI generates it instantly, matched to your brand colors.

The image enhancement tools also automatically adjust brightness, contrast, and sizing to fit your layout perfectly—no external image editor required.

How It Compares to Traditional Elementor Building

Traditional Elementor building gives you complete manual control over every pixel. The AI approach offers a middle ground: automation for repetitive tasks with human oversight for critical decisions. You can accept, modify, or reject every AI suggestion, ensuring the final result reflects your vision.

This hybrid model is particularly valuable for agencies and freelancers who need to deliver high-quality work efficiently. Instead of spending hours on initial layouts, designers can focus their energy on customization, branding, and client-specific refinements.

Getting Started With Elementor AI

Elementor’s AI features are available through the Elementor Pro subscription with the AI add-on. The setup is straightforward—no complex configurations or API keys to manage. Once activated, the AI tools appear naturally within the existing Elementor interface.

For best results, start with clear goals for each page. The more context you provide to the AI—industry type, target audience, desired tone—the better its suggestions will align with your needs.
